Ingredients: 400 grams of high-gluten flour, 50 grams of raisins, 80 grams of sugar, 150 grams of milk, 40 grams of butter, 3 grams of salt, 6 grams of yeast, one egg
-
Soak the raisins in water until soft, wash them, remove and drain the water, and dry the raisins with a damp cloth or kitchen towel
-
Add eggs
-
milk
-
White sugar salt
-
High-gluten flour, put yeast on top of the flour
-
After all the ingredients are put into the bread machine, stir for 20 minutes until smooth
-
Add butter and mix for another 20 minutes to form a smooth and stretchable dough
-
I kneaded it for a long time myself) put it into the bread machine and closed the lid for basic fermentation. (The bread machine is not powered on)
-
Fermentation will be doubled
-
After the fermented dough is deflated and rounded, place it in the bread machine and cover it to rest for about 10 minutes
-
Roll into oval shape. Slowly roll it out to all sides into a rectangular shape
-
Turn over and spread raisins on half of the dough. Fold the dough sheet in half, press and pinch the three sides with your hands
-
Place in a baking pan and place in a warm and moist place for secondary fermentation. Brush the fermented dough evenly with egg wash. Does it look like a big dumpling
-
Oven baking setting: Preheat at 160°C for 5 minutes, place in baking pan and bake for 30 minutes
-
That’s it.
